How they compare
Thailand currently reports 502 against 317 in Norway, a difference of 185.
That makes Thailand's figure about 1.6 times Norway's.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 18 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Thailand ahead.
Norway ranks 15th and Thailand ranks 13th of 121 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Norway averaged higher in 1 and Thailand in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Norway | Thailand |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 20 | 27 | 7 | Thailand |
| 2000s | 87.12 | 98.12 | 11 | Thailand |
| 2010s | 294.4 | 276.8 | 17.6 | Norway |
| 2020s | 422 | 555.5 | 133.5 | Thailand |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
